Columbia Mall, also known as CM, is a more than 250,000-square-foot facility that provides a variety of electronic and gift items. Established in 1981, it offers apparel, jewelry items, shoes, kiosks, sporting goods, and specialty and health care products. The mall has departmental stores of JC Penney, Peebles and Sears. Columbia Mall provides products from Bath & Body Works, Glamorous Nails and Marie's Hair Company. It organizes Red Cross Blood Drive and Free Blood Pressure Checks events.
